Boston: Lee and Shepard, 1886. 1886 Printing (first was 1868). NEAR FINE. A beautiful copy - clean, totally unmarked and firmly bound. Pages fine, unblemished. Hardcover is of light gray paper over boards, printed in black, with dark brown-black cloth spine. Cover is clean and square with only slight edge rubbing. Hinges and binding firm, intact and straight. Bees, moths, butterflies, beetles, cockroaches, cicadas, locusts, may-flies, spiders, crabs, lobsters, worms and more. Beautifully illustrated with 124 delicately rendered black and white wood engravings. A wonderful survivor! 5 x 7"; 150 pages plus 8 pages of publisher ads at rear.. Hard Cover. Near Fine/No Jacket.
